DRAWING SKILLS, COMPUTERS AND THE CREATIVE PROCESSCORRECT OBSERVATION. Learning to draw is realIy a matter of learning to see - to see correctly -and that means a good deal more than merely looking with the eye. Thesort of ‘seeing’ I mean is an observation that utilizes as many of the fi vesenses as can reach through the eye at one time. Although you use youreyes, you do not cIose up the other senses - rather, the reverse, becauseall the senses have a part in the sort of observation you are to make. For example, you know sandpaper by the way it feels when you touch it. You know a skunk more by odor than by appearance, an orange by the way it tastes. You recognize the difference between a piano and a violin when you hear them over the radio without seeing them at all.

Perspective drawings typically have an -often implied- horizon line. This line, directly opposite the viewer’s eye, represents objects infi nitely far away. They have shrunk, in the distance, to the infi nitesimal thickness of a line. It is analogous to (and named after) the Earth’s horizon.
